Output 67dff926530543f22631c8075ee108170669c0997388a2766eeb30f19a7ea71f:0

value
601340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ce20efd4656a0de159420f010b8857c76870920 OP_EQUAL
address
37EwGspxhs6GyqXay1fCzRDfN4W4dBxJ2u
transaction
67dff926530543f22631c8075ee108170669c0997388a2766eeb30f19a7ea71f
spent
true